* [PATCH] Revert "cpufreq: intel_pstate: Fix ->set_policy() interface for no_turbo" @ 2018-08-04 15:29 Gabriele Mazzotta 2018-08-04 17:31 ` Gabriele Mazzotta 0 siblings, 1 reply; 9+ messages in thread From: Gabriele Mazzotta @ 2018-08-04 15:29 UTC (permalink / raw) To: srinivas.pandruvada, rjw Cc: lenb, viresh.kumar, linux-pm, linux-kernel, Gabriele Mazzotta This change does not take into account that some BIOSes change MSR_IA32_MISC_ENABLE_TURBO_DISABLE depending on the power source. If the turbo is disabled when the system boots, policy.max_freq is set to pstate.max_pstate. However, if the BIOS later enables the turbo, the CPU will never be able to run at pstate.turbo_pstate. Since now intel_pstate_set_policy() does its calculations using pstate.max_freq and pstate.turbo_freq, we can always calculate cpuinfo.max_freq using pstate.turbo_pstate, thus allowing system with varying MSR_IA32_MISC_ENABLE_TURBO_DISABLE to run at full speed when the turbo is enabled. This reverts commit 983e600e88835f0321d1a0ea06f52d48b7b5a544. Well, the problem with this approach is that always using pstate.turbo_pstate as the max causes the governor to overestimate the target frequency when the turbo range is not available (the target depends on the width of the entire available P-state range including turbo, so if the turbo range is not available, the number take into that computation is too large). Are we expected to get notified when the BIOS updates MSR_IA32_MISC_ENABLE_TURBO_DISABLE? ^ permalink raw reply [flat|nested] 9+ messages in thread
